In the blink of an eye, it was already Wang Chen’s seventh day in Area Ji-9.

During this time, he had essentially adapted to the harsh environment here and became familiar with the basic situation within the prison zone.

Although the Yin Sha Energy in Area Ji-9 was dense, it could not erode Wang Chen’s Vajra Immortality.

His Qi-Blood was extremely robust, far surpassing his Cultivation Realm, and without deliberate precautions, he could naturally isolate the invasion of Evil Power and malice.

On this point, Wang Chen was stronger than any prison guard in Area Ji-9!@@novelbin@@

He felt that enduring three years here would not be a problem.

“Brother Wang…”

In the afternoon, when Wang Chen was once again patrolling in front of Yu Fei’s cell, this enchantress from the Hehuan Sect suddenly spoke up, “If I remember correctly, tomorrow is your day off, isn’t it?”

Wang Chen was slightly startled and nodded in response, “Yes, that’s right.”

Official prison guards had a day off every seven days; tomorrow he would indeed be able to temporarily escape the “bitter sea” and relax a bit back in the Immortal City.

The pressure of a prison guard’s work was originally immense; the environment was so terrible that if they had to stay underground where the sun never shone all year long, enduring the invasion of Yin Sha Energy and the curses of malicious thoughts from the prisoners, no one could persist for a long period.

Even if prison guards were expendable, the Forbidden Prison Department still had to consider cost-effectiveness.

In fact, apart from the regular day off every seven days, official prison guards also had ten days of annual leave.

“Could you bring me a box of eyebrow rouge from the Fragrant Sky Pavilion?”

Yu Fei pleaded pitifully, “My lord, it has been such a long time since I have applied makeup.”

“Uh…”

Wang Chen was at a loss.

It was not that Wang Chen was unwilling to help; he and Yu Fei could be considered old acquaintances, and despite having been teased by this enchantress from the Hehuan Sect in the past, he could feel that she bore no ill will.

The same went for Area Ji-9.

Moreover, although Yu Fei was confined in a heavily sealed cell, she was well-informed and very familiar with the Yongle Dungeon, having given Wang Chen quite a few pointers.

In comparison, bringing a box of rouge seemed a trivial matter!

The problem lay in the regulations of the Forbidden Prison Department, which stated that prison guards like Wang Chen could talk to prisoners, but they could not offer any kind of assistance.

Bringing things into the prison from the outside for a prisoner was decidedly a taboo!

If caught, Wang Chen might end up as Yu Fei’s next-door neighbor.

“Sorry.”

Wang Chen’s relationship with Yu Fei wasn’t close enough to take such a risk on her behalf, and he shook his head, saying, “Fellow Daoist should know the rules, I really can’t help you with this.”

“Rules are nothing but human sentiments.”

Yu Fei giggled and said, “Brother Wang, as long as you deliver this item to Prison Department Leader Cao, he will agree to my request for you to bring the rouge.”

As she spoke, a delicate jade hand reached out through the stone door’s window.

Between two fingers that resembled spring onions, she held a hairpin.

The hairpin appeared to be made of pure gold, its design and craftsmanship quite exquisite, shining with a soft glow.

Wang Chen instinctively took it.

Yu Fei withdrew her hand and murmured, “Brother Wang, you are a good person. Once I am released, I will surely find you a dao companion who is still a virgin in the sect.”

This promise was rather tempting…

Wang Chen received her metaphorical ‘good person card’ with a wry smile.

After finishing the afternoon’s patrol tasks, he first went to the Supervisory Hall to clock out from work, then sought an audience with Prison Department Leader Cao.

Prison Department Leader Cao was one of the top three figures in Area Ji-9, a Cultivator at the peak of the Purple Mansion Realm.

This middle-aged Cultivator was not given to smiles or laughter, as solemn as an old pedant whose brain had been overwhelmed with too much study.

In front of him, the prison guards of Area Ji-9, whether new recruits or seasoned veterans, barely dared to breathe loudly.

Prison Department Leader Cao’s stern impartiality and indifference to personal connections were notorious.

Wang Chen suspected that Yu Fei was setting a trap for him.

Yet, no matter how much he pondered, he couldn’t fathom why this female cultivator from Hehuan Sect would deliberately scheme against him. More importantly, his intuition hadn’t detected the slightest malice from her.

Thus, out of curiosity, Wang Chen laid out the entire matter before Prison Department Leader Cao after meeting him, without the slightest intention to withhold or conceal anything.

His approach was impeccable and fully in line with the dungeon rules.

This way, even if Yu Fei had some devious plan, it would have nothing to do with Wang Chen.

After speaking, Wang Chen respectfully presented the gold hairpin.

Prison Department Leader Cao accepted it expressionlessly.

At that moment, Wang Chen keenly noticed a very subtle twitch of Leader Cao’s right pinky.

This was knowing that Prison Department Leader Cao was a peak-level Purple Mansion cultivator!

“You’ve done well.”

Prison Department Leader Cao, without looking, slipped the gold hairpin into his sleeve and said indifferently, “This enchantress from Hehuan Sect is crafty and loves to toy with people’s hearts. Don’t think she’ll give you the cold shoulder. Enchantresses are heartless.”

Pausing, he continued, “But she is a prisoner designated by higher-ups to be closely guarded and serves a very important purpose. Take her a box of eyebrow rouge from Fragrant Sky Pavilion.”

Hmm?

Wang Chen wondered if he had misheard—this was a rather abrupt twist!

“Lower cultivator obeys the order.”

But Wang Chen wasn’t about to question the command, so naturally, he showed complete obedience.

A rank higher in office could be crushing, not to mention being several ranks higher!

“Go.”

Prison Department Leader Cao waved him off and added, “In the future, anything involving this Hehuan Sect enchantress should be reported directly to me. You must never take matters into your own hands.”

“Yes!”

Having left the Supervisory Hall, Wang Chen couldn’t help but sigh deeply.

For some reason, he always felt that the atmosphere inside the Supervisory Hall, despite being protected by an array, was especially stiff and oppressive, far less comfortable than outside.

Each supervisor and warden, like clay Bodhisattvas, always liked to put on airs.

It was quite irritating.

Muttering complaints to himself, Wang Chen used the Transmission Array of Yi Nine District and arrived in Yongle Immortal City.

As a mere Loose Cultivator who had now become nothing more than an ordinary “front-line” prison guard, he naturally didn’t have a dwelling in the expensive Immortal City.

Fortunately, Wang Chen hadn’t planned on staying overnight in the city.

He visited a general store to buy some items needed for his daily work duties, and only then did he head to Myriad Treasures Pavilion in Yongle Immortal City.

Myriad Treasures Pavilion was the largest merchant in the Mountain and Sea Realm and also operated its own branch stores in the Haotian Realm.

As a Purple Mansion cultivator, Wang Chen received better service.

A shopkeeper personally attended to “serve” Wang Chen.

“I’m just buying a box of rouge, that’s all.”

Wang Chen had not expected the usually aloof Myriad Treasures shopkeeper to be flustered, as if Wang Chen was not buying a box of rouge, but some exotic item from beyond the skies.

But Wang Chen quickly realized that he truly needed such a professional’s help!

“Preorder, you mean to say buying a box of rouge requires placing an order and waiting for it?”
